Tennessee
US State
Tennessee is a landlocked state in the U.S. South. Its capital, centrally located Nashville, is the heart of the country-music scene, with the long-running Grand Ole Opry, the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um and a legendary stretch of honky-tonks and dance halls. Memphis, in the far southwest, is the home of Elvis Presley’s Graceland, rock-and-roll pioneering Sun Studio and the blues clubs of Beale Street. ― Googlev

Nashville
City in Tennessee
Nashville is the capital of the U.S. state of Tennessee and home to Vanderbilt University. Legendary country music venues include the Grand Ole Opry House, home of the famous “Grand Ole Opry” stage and radio show. The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um and historic Ryman Auditorium are Downtown, as is the District, featuring honky-tonks with live music and the Johnny Cash Museum, celebrating the singer's life. ― Google

Knoxville is one of the biggest tourist attractions in USA having many best places in Knoxville. Knoxville is a city on the Tennessee River in eastern Tennessee. Downtown, the Market Square district has 19th-century buildings with shops and restaurants. The Museum of East Tennessee History has interactive exhibits plus regional art, textiles and Civil War artifacts. James White’s Fort, built by the Revolutionary War captain, includes the reconstructed 1786 log cabin that was Knoxville’s first permanent building. Forty years ago, 11-million people from all over the world descended on Knoxville for one of the most popular expos America has ever put on. The 1982 World’s Fair put this scruffy city on the banks of the Tennessee River on the map and some people who attended during the expo’s six-month run never left.

With a growing population of just under 200-thousand, Knoxville is more popular than ever. People gravitate here for its natural beauty and some of the nicest, most hospitable folks you’ll find anywhere.

Moving on to number 5, we have the Ijams Nature Center: With over 300 acres of pristine land, it offers a diverse range of activities, including hiking, birdwatching, and paddling in the Tennessee River. Encounter stunning wildlife and explore picturesque trails through lush forests and serene waterways. Ijams Nature Center promises a rejuvenating escape and an opportunity to connect with nature in a unique and memorable way.


At number 4, we recommend visiting the Knoxville's Urban Wilderness: This unique destination offers a harmonious blend of outdoor adventures and city conveniences. Explore over 50 miles of diverse trails, lush forests, serene lakes, and scenic viewpoints. Whether you're into hiking, biking, or simply seeking tranquility amidst nature, Knoxville's Urban Wilderness promises a refreshing and enriching escape for all.


At number 3, we highly recommend a Knoxville Riverwalk: This scenic trail along the Tennessee River offers breathtaking views of the water and the city's skyline. Whether you're strolling, jogging, or biking, the Riverwalk's serene ambiance and lush surroundings provide a rejuvenating escape from the urban bustle. It's an ideal spot to connect with nature, unwind, and soak in the beauty of Knoxville's riverfront.


Now, let's unveil number 2 on our list— East Tennessee History Center: This center offers a fascinating journey through the region's rich history, showcasing its cultural heritage, notable figures, and pivotal events. From engaging exhibits to well-preserved artifacts, the East Tennessee History Center provides an immersive and educational opportunity to gain insight into the area's past and gain a deeper appreciation for its significance in American history.



Finally, securing the number 1 spot on our list is the McClung Museum of Natural History & Culture: This is a must-visit destination for its captivating exhibits that celebrate the rich diversity of the natural world and human cultures. Through immersive displays and interactive experiences, visitors can delve into the wonders of history, anthropology, and archaeology. With its engaging collections and educational opportunities, the museum offers an enriching and enlightening experience for all ages, making it a truly memorable and educational outing.

10. Grand Rapids, Michigan
Grand Rapids is a beautiful city, and it's the perfect place to raise a family. You probably heard that it is one of the cheapest cities to live in the USA. That's right! Grand Rapids has a significantly lower cost of living compared to other major U.S. metro areas. Even though the city's annual average income is lower than the national average, the area allows you to make the most of your money. Despite price growth, housing costs are lower than the national median. Additionally, Grand Rapidians spend less on basic expenses than people in other parts of the country, including groceries and medical care. But not just the low cost of living that makes Grand Rapids a great city - it's also the quality of life. Grand Rapids has a thriving arts and culture scene. And, of course, it's not far from some of the most beautiful natural scenery in the country. So if you're looking for an affordable place to live with a high quality of life, you may check out Grand Rapids, Michigan.
9.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ania
This charming city has a population of just over 300,000 people, making it the perfect size for those who want to avoid the hustle and bustle of a big city but still have access to all the amenities they need. The cost of living in Pittsburgh is relatively low, and plenty of affordable housing options are available. Additionally, Pittsburgh is home to several employers, so finding a job shouldn't be a problem. In fact, the increase in employment options has made Pittsburgh a desirable location for families and graduates. Compared to other major cities, Pittsburgh has a more affordable housing market. With new industries moving to Pittsburgh, Pittsburgh's outdated reputation as a blue-collar city is being replaced, and the quality of living continues to rise.

8. Fayetteville, Arkansas
The drastic growth being experienced in the cities around Fayetteville is drawing attention to the city. Now, we’ve found that it’s one of the cities with the most affordable cost of living. No wonder the location that used to be a small town has metamorphosed into a city of culture, commerce, and entrepreneurship, crowned with the presence of higher education. It is home to the University of Arkansas, the birthplace of Walmart, and the headquarters of Tyson Foods. To live in this city, the median monthly rent is just 868 dollars while the median home price is 203,150 dollars if you desire to own a home. If you put that side-by-side with the average annual salary of 50,470 dollars and an unemployment rate of just 4.7 percent, you will understand why people from all over the world call Fayetteville home.

A ridge upon a ridge of forest straddles the border between North Carolina and Tennessee in Great Smoky Mountains National Park. World renowned for its diversity of plant and animal life, the beauty of its ancient mountains, and the quality of its remnants of Southern Appalachian mountain culture, this is America's most visited national park.
